Hess says Papua discovery non-commercial

Thursday, January 26 2012 - 02:13 AM WIB

By Alexander Ginting

US oil, gas independent firm Hess Corporation reported on Wednesday that the Anadalan-1 well in Semai V deepwater exploration block offshore West Papua failed to discover hydrocarbon at commercial quantity.

?In terms of exploration, the Andalan -1 well on the Semai V Block in Indonesia encountered reservoir sands and hydrocarbons, but not in commercial quantities. This well, along with a follow up well, was expensed in the fourth quarter,? the company said without giving further detail.

The Andalan-1, which spud on July 12, 2011, was the first well drilled by Hess in the block.

Hess has 100% interest in the block, which covers an area of 3,949 square kilometer in the deep waters off West Papua.
